Abstract: In order to study of the effect of Cycocel (CCC)
dosages and pollination methods on alfalfa seed production an experiment was
conducted using split plot design
based on randomized complete block with three replications in Borujerd
agricultural research station, Iran for two years (2011-12). In split plot
designthree artificial pollination
systems (control, pulling rope over flowers in 70% and 100% pollination stages)
were used as main plots and the four hormone dosages (0,
1.6, 3.2 and 6.4 liter per hectare) as sub plots. The results of variance
analysis indicated that the influence of artificial pollination and mutual
influence of the hormone in artificial pollination on traits such as, bush
highness, stem diameter, and internodes distance have been significant. The
effect of Cycocel hormone other traits: bush highness, stem
diameter, and internodes distance at 5% level has become significant.
